How To Record Video With Macbook Air?

Recording videos with your MacBook Air is a convenient and straightforward process that can be done using the built-in camera. In this article, we will guide you through the steps to record videos effortlessly.

Using QuickTime Player

One of the easiest ways to record a video on your MacBook Air is by using the QuickTime Player application. To initiate the recording process, launch the QuickTime Player app on your Mac.

Accessing Recording Options

Once you have the QuickTime Player app open, navigate to the top menu and select “File.” From the dropdown menu, choose “New Movie Recording” to access the recording controls for your video.

Activating the Camera

After selecting “New Movie Recording,” you will notice a green light next to the built-in camera on your MacBook Air. This indicates that the camera is active and ready to start recording.

Starting the Recording

To begin recording your video, simply click on the record button in the QuickTime Player interface. This will initiate the recording process, and you will see the timer counting the duration of your video.

Pausing and Resuming

If you need to pause the recording at any point, you can do so by clicking the pause button in the QuickTime Player controls. To resume the recording, click the same button again.

Stopping the Recording

Once you have finished recording your video, you can stop the recording by clicking on the stop button in the QuickTime Player interface. This will finalize the recording process.

Saving the Video

After stopping the recording, you will be prompted to save the video file. Choose a suitable location on your MacBook Air to save the video and give it a descriptive name.

Editing the Video

If you wish to edit the recorded video, you can do so using various video editing software available for Mac. Import the video file into the editing tool to make any necessary adjustments.

Sharing the Video

Once you have your video ready, you can easily share it with others by uploading it to video-sharing platforms, social media, or sending it via email directly from your MacBook Air.
